5 KW Solar Panel price in Kerala: An overview
The overall cost for a 5 KW solar panel actually varies depending on several components and their quality, along with the brand name. Apart from these, you need manpower and technical expertise for installation. By recognising its potential, you may like to understand the 5 KW Solar Panel price range and see if it fits your budget. The good news is that the Government of India is providing financial assistance, and you can look for the 5 kW Solar Panel subsidy rate on the scheme.
The following pricing is a general estimation for a 5 KW Solar Panel in Kerala without subsidies.
| System Type | Estimated Price (5 KW) | Description |
|---|---|---|
| On-Grid System (Grid-tied) | ₹2.2 - ₹3.3 Lakhs | Lowest cost option, no battery required. Exports excess electricity to the grid. |
| Off-Grid System (With Battery) | ₹3.1 - ₹5.4 Lakhs | Higher cost due to battery storage. Ideal for areas with frequent power cuts. |
| Hybrid System (Grid + Battery) | ₹3.8 - ₹5.8 Lakhs | Combines grid connectivity with battery backup for maximum flexibility. |
5 KW Solar panel subsidy
The Government of India understand the possible benefits of going fully solar in India. So, it provides a subsidy for different solar capacities starting from 1 KW to 10 KW. The subsidy is fixed across different capacities and can be easily accessed by submitting an application online. So far, more than 2,00000 households have benefited from the scheme. In Kerala, the subsidy is implemented through KSEBL. For a 5 KW solar panel installation, the subsidy is not linear but a fixed amount of exactly 78,000 rupees.
Things required for online submission
- You must be a residential consumer
- You should have a valid electricity connection and sufficient shadow-free roof space (approx. 450-500 sq. ft.).

Besides, 5 kWp rooftop solar systems estimate a payback period from 3 to 6 years, heavily influenced by government subsidies. For an on-grid system, the timeframe is usually 3 to 5 years, whereas for a hybrid system, the payback period stretches to 6 to 9 years.

FAQ(Frequently Asked Question)
1. How much does it cost to set up a 5 KW solar panel?
2 to 6 Lakh, depending on the type of model and components, without subsidy.
2. What is the maximum amount of subsidy for a 5 KW solar panel?
For a 5 KW Solar panel installation, you can get a maximum of 78,000 rupees through PM Surya Ghar
3. What is the capacity of a 5 KW solar panel?
Generally, a 5 KW solar panel can generate 15 to 25 units in a day
4. What is the process to get the subsidy?
You must register on the PM Surya Ghar portal (pmsuryaghar.gov.in) and use an authorised vendor for installation.
5. What is the payback period?
The system generally pays for itself within 4 to 6 years through reduced electricity bills.
